Medical malpractice happens when a healthcare provider fails to meet the acceptable standard of care, and a patient suffers harm as a result. It can lead to devastating consequences for patients and their families, both physically and emotionally.

If you or a loved one has experienced any type of malpractice involving your healthcare, it is essential to know what steps to take to protect your rights and get the compensation you deserve. A medical malpractice lawyer in Ohio will be able to help you with the many aspects of building your case and preparing to face off against the insurance companies.

However, there are a number of things that you will need to do to make sure that you have all of your bases covered, legally speaking. Here are five steps you should take after experiencing any form of medical malpractice:

Contact an experienced medical malpractice attorney.
Although we mentioned this briefly in our opening, it is the most important aspect of putting together a successful case. It is virtually impossible to navigate these kinds of legal waters without representation.

Working with an experienced attorney is crucial to helping you understand your legal rights and options. A qualified lawyer can also investigate your case and gather evidence to solidify your case.

Seek medical attention.

 The first thing you should do after experiencing malpractice is seek medical attention. You need to ensure that your health and well-being are taken care of. This may involve seeing a different healthcare provider or even seeking specialized medical care. Keep all medical records and bills related to any treatment you received.

Document everything that happens.

 Documentation is crucial in these types of cases. Keep a detailed record of everything related to your case, including the medical treatment you received, dates of appointments, any prescriptions or treatments prescribed, and any communication you have had with your healthcare provider. As mentioned in the previous section, it is essential to keep track of any expenses related to your medical treatment or missed work due to your injury.

Communicate regularly with your attorney.

Once you have hired a medical malpractice lawyers Ohio, it is essential to cooperate easily and fully with them. Provide them with all the documentation and information they need to build a strong case on your behalf. Your attorney may also have you undergo an independent medical evaluation to help build your case further.

Continue to be patient.

 Medical malpractice cases can take time to resolve. It is essential to be patient and trust the legal process. Your attorney will work diligently on your case to ensure to protect your legal rights and make sure that you or your loved one is compensated accordingly.

In Conclusion

Going through medical malpractice can be a traumatic experience for patients and their families. However, by taking the appropriate steps, you can ensure that justice is served and that you receive the compensation you need to move forward after your case.
